    Default [4xShaman Arena] Totem Loadout Changes

    This is my latest totem loadout, I'd welcome feedback. I've only had a little bit of time in the BGs/Arenas, so I'm still on the fence about a few issues. I do not use a cast sequence mod, I simply have 4 keys bound for PvP totem dropping (U-I-O-P). I press them in that order, as well, so my characters drop:

    Button U: 1-Wrath of Air, 2-Grounding, 3-Tremor, 4-Healing
    Button I: 1-Poison, 2-Earthbind, 3-Grounding, 4-Tremor
    Button O: 1-Tremor, 2-Poison, 3-Healing, 4-Grounding
    Button P: 1-Searing, 2-Searing, 3-Searing, 4-Searing

    My current tradeoffs/considerations:

    * I run with 3xTremors and 1xEarthbind. This seems to give me good fear resistance (should be better in patch 2.4) and I do like having an earthbind down to deal with melee folks or mages who want to jump around on my team and mash arcane explosion. I think it's a good tradeoff vs. 4xTremor, but I'd welcome feedback here. Character "1" is my main, so I lay down staggered tremors with a /follower going first to avoid an easy wand/melee kill.

    * I run with 3xGrounding and Wrath of Air. My guys are still a little undergeared, so I hope the extra spell damage makes a difference. I often drop a 4xGrounding mid-fight to refresh, so the WoA may not always be up. I'd love feedback about this choice, because I'm not sold on it and may just do 4x grounding. Also would like feedback on staggering these. My key concern is to get at least one down ASAP.

    * I run with 2xPoison/2xHealing. I could see going to 4xPoison, since rogues are such a pain for me. I'd love input here!! This is the totem class I'm least set on.

    * I have re-arranged my sequence so that the searings are all on the fourth button press. I used to have them staggered. Often times, I will just lay down 12 totems, expecting to need to use a 4xFire Nova drop on a melee. If I'm on the move, this gives me a chance to get totem protection up with 3 GCDs instead of a full 4, and I can still use 4xSearings if I have the time to lay them down (they are handy for extra DPS and pointing the way to nearby enemies I may not instantly see).

    Mmmmm. I go with full four Tremor Totems and I have them in a castsequence with Mana Spring. So two of my guys drop Tremor and two drop Mana on first click, then second click i get the opposite. That staggers Tremor fairly well. I used to have it alternate with Grounding but I found that I preferred to just have one button to drop 4 Grounding Totems. Looking at your setup though, I may well go with 1 Mana/1 Poison/2 Tremor and then the opposite. Hmmmm.

    I have Wrath of Air and Earthbind as single keyclicks only on my main and just have'em on the hotbar for the others. I'd rather be able to drop them situationally since I've found I'd rather have the extra fear coverage than an Earthbind that may or may not be worth anything... Especially considering how hard it is to get a cast off on someone who's jumping around even if they are Earthbound. That's what 2x FS/2x ES and Fire Nova is for

    I use a similar setup. I was going with the 4 grounding totems in one key press at first, but found that if the other team charged straight across and feared, then I was screwed, so I swapped to a method to get my initial 16 totems down in the first 4 GCDs. I still have a single button to drop 4 grounding totems which I use to refresh them. I feel a lot more comfortable now about getting a mix of totem down now in the first 8 seconds than I did by dropping 4 grounding and then the others.

    I use staggered cast sequences.

    /cast sequence reset=15 Tremor Totem, Grounding Totem, Searing Totem, Mana Spring Totem
    /cast sequence reset=15 Grounding Totem, Tremor Totem, Poison Cleansing Totem, Searing Totem
    /cast sequence reset=15 Poison Cleansing Totem, Searing Totem, Tremor Totem, Grounding Totem
    /cast sequence reset=15 Grounding Totem, Posion Cleansing Totem, Searing Totem, Earthbind Totem

    You need to space out your tremors to get the maximum benefit. Dropping two at once isn't going to shorten the fear duration any. By spreading them out, each one will pulse at a different time thereby limiting how long you are feared. I'm not sure if that is why he was saying 3 seconds or not though.
